Transaction 75f7faabc8ce36d09024a040b4172665058973436a3e768281e516ef84cb0bc1

1 Input
2 Outputs
  • 75f7faabc8ce36d09024a040b4172665058973436a3e768281e516ef84cb0bc1:0
  • value  63910
    address  3CuRUFcU6ZwtQRTthHdryAFEB84YG6Z6oh
  • 75f7faabc8ce36d09024a040b4172665058973436a3e768281e516ef84cb0bc1:1
  • value  97028
    address  3NxnL7Wu89ZQStZgek489RuQUUgR4pk8gT